“…This is further addressed by Metha [18] that tests the correctness of network verifiers compared to the behavior of real devices using fuzzing and combinatorial testing, and it uses delta debugging for fault localization. To scale network configuration verification further, Kirigami [161] and Timepiece [5] introduce modular control plane verification that allows parallel verification.…”
